Misys Healthcare Systems                        9 Pages

The Misys Corporation is a well know software services provider in the financial vertical. 25 years in this business and its market expansion through partnerships and joint ventures are impressive. But off late it seems to have lost it’s focus from its core competencies and the declining revenues are proof of it. Nevertheless the company is divesting its non-core business areas slowly and refocusing on the customers and expanding its product line accordingly. Misys Healthcare Systems is active mainly in the US. Historically the company has always had a strong position in the finance vertical, however with some of its strategic acquisitions, it is strengthening its position in the healthcare vertical as well. The most eye-catching acquisition is of Patient1 product line from Per Se Technologies. The high market demand for CPR and CPOE solutions (which are core components of Patient1 product line as well) will provide Misys with ample opportunities in this area. Misys also has its own product line of departmental information systems (LIS, RIS, Pharmacy, etc.), which are again potentially high growth markets. Although the return on shareholders value has been declining, TekPlus expects the company to bounce back given its management experience as well as the growth expected in some of its key markets. Misys needs not only to refocus its priorities but also to rapidly execute on them.
